Support: the zero-downtime schema migration runner on the Corvane cluster has drifted from the committed config. Lock timeouts and batch sizes were changed in place during last month's backfill and never reverted. Symptoms customers may report: migrations stalling mid-expand phase or dual-write verification taking longer than expected. Do not restart the runner mid-migration; it will resume from the last checkpoint on its own. Escalate anything stuck past two hours. The values currently active on the cluster are recorded below.

service settings:
PRAIX_LOG_LEVEL=error
PRAIX_METRICS_HOST=metrics.praix.qorvelcorp.corp
PRAIX_POOL_SIZE=16

## Building Access — Cleaning Crew (Marwick House)

The Brightfern cleaning crew services floors 2 through 5 on weekday evenings after 18:00. Team assistants do not need to stay on site, but should ensure meeting rooms are unlocked and personal items cleared from desks. The crew enters via the loading-dock door, which requires the current service entrance code provided below.

turnstile pass: bdg-QZV-3

## Further reading

If you're cutting a release of Spandiff, our large-file diff viewer, there are a few docs worth skimming first. The chunked-rendering design note explains why we cap hunks at 10k lines, and the memory-budget doc covers the mmap fallback on older kernels. Both saved past release managers from shipping regressions. The whole collection, including the release checklist itself, is gathered on one internal page.

runbook for tajep-yahig: https://artifactory.lumictech.corp/repo

### Runbook: Tumblerow Locker Access Flow

When a resident scans their fob at a Tumblerow laundry locker, the kiosk requests a short-lived grant from the access broker, which validates the fob against the tenancy roster before unlocking. Grants expire quickly and are single-use; the kiosk never caches them. For your review, note that offline fallback allows a limited number of unlocks per door per hour when the broker is unreachable, which is the main risk surface. The broker's current configuration values are as follows.

service settings:
novath:
  pin: 1396
  tenant: pelys
  seal: seal_ccc035e1
  metrics_host: metrics.novath.qorvelworks.test
  standby_team: fraeth
  escalation: drueth-zorok
  nonce: 61d508